Environement Awareness

Rural areas are among the first to suffer from the impacts of climate change: that may include a lack of rainfall for crops, droughts, and the emergence of new diseases. Additionally, India is one of the countries least sensitized to climate change and its causes.

 

The AIRD plans to raise awareness about the environmental crisis by educating communities on sustainable practices, promoting recycling, and encouraging healthy habits. A common initiative is the Cleaning & Waste Day where the AIRD along with the Village Development Committees (VDC), work together to clean villages, remove waste, and educate residents on environmental good practices. To improve village sanitation, we are sometimes organizing distribution of dustbins, and plastic collection to enhance waste management.

Community members, VDC members, and school students participate in activities like tree planting. In an effort to reduce CO2 emissions and promote renewable energy, in the second half of 2020, one of our main plans was working towards creating "zero-darkness" villages by installing solar streetlights in 9 of our villages, providing around 1,000 households with access to sustainable lighting.

Tree Plantation

One of our key initiatives in environmental protection is our Tree Plantation. Trees play a critical role in maintaining ecological balance, reducing carbon footprints, and combating climate change. Through our campaigns, we plant thousands of trees in deforested areas, along roadsides, and in community spaces. These trees not only help improve air quality but also provide shade, reduce soil erosion, and create habitats for wildlife. Our tree-planting efforts are a long-term investment in the health of the planet and the well-being of future generations.

Dustbins distribution

As part of our environmental protection efforts, AIRD distributes dustbins to local communities to promote proper waste management and reduce pollution. By providing these essential tools, we help create cleaner, healthier environments while encouraging residents to take an active role in keeping their surroundings litter-free. This initiative not only improves sanitation but also raises awareness about the importance of reducing waste and adopting sustainable habits.
